FreeBSD 6.0-RELEASE+Dummynet+Bridging



Hello, all. I am running the subject software on a Dell Dimension 3000 desktop with two Ethernet interfaces (using the em and fxp drivers). The kernel modules that are being used are dummynet.ko, ipfw.ko, and if_bridge.ko. After setting up the pipes, etc. the platform runs as expected doing its bridging and desired dummynet traffic shaping function but consistently crashes the platform after about 15 minutes requiring a power off/on restart (or logging in on a virtual terminal and issuing a shutdown). If I just do bridging with IPFW but without dummynet.ko loaded everything is fine. The same behavior results if I recompile the kernel to support firewalling and dummynet.

I am consistently obtaining what appears to be a FIFO overrun (kernel: em0: Rx overrun).

I also tried all this with an IBM T22 Thinkpad (internal + PC Card Ethernet interfaces) and got the same result. Has anyone had a similar experience and found a fix? Thanks for your time and comment. Sincerely,
